How this is worked out

  1. Take both airports' published coordinates from OurAirports — nothing here is scraped from another flight site.
  2. Great-circle distance by haversine on a mean earth radius of 6,371.0088 km: 1,082 km.
  3. Airborne time = that distance ÷ 805 km/h, a representative jet cruise speed: 1h 21m.
  4. Add a flat 25 minutes for pushback, taxi, climb, descent and taxi-in — the reason a 400 km hop is never half an hour: 1h 46m gate to gate.
  5. Winds, aircraft type and airline schedule padding are not modelled. The cruise-speed table shows how much that assumption is worth.
1,082 km / 805 km/h = 1h 21m airborne
            + 25 min ground = 1h 46m gate to gate

Flight time at different cruise speeds

Aircraft type, winds and routing all move the real number. This is the same distance flown at different speeds, plus the 25-minute ground and climb allowance.

Typical ofCruise speedAirborneGate to gate
Turboprop / regional550 km/h1h 58m2h 23m
Narrowbody jet (A320, 737)780 km/h1h 23m1h 48m
Widebody jet (777, 787, A350)900 km/h1h 12m1h 37m
Private jet (Gulfstream)850 km/h1h 16m1h 42m

Headwinds on an eastbound long-haul routinely add 30–60 minutes; the same route westbound can be quicker. Airlines publish schedules with padding built in.

How far is Otopeni from Prague?

1,082 kilometres in a straight line over the earth's surface — 672 miles or 584 nautical miles. Actual flown distance is usually 2–5% longer because aircraft follow airways, avoid weather and route around restricted airspace.
